What to do and see while visiting Plettenberg Bay on the Garden Route

Welcome to Plettenberg Bay, affectionately known as Plet or Plett by the locals. This charming coastal town on the Garden Route of South Africa offers a plethora of activities and sights for visitors to enjoy. Whether you’re a nature lover, beach bum, adventure enthusiast, or simply looking for a relaxing getaway, Plettenberg Bay has something for everyone.

Here are some must-do activities and sights to add to your itinerary while visiting Plettenberg Bay:

1. Explore Robberg Nature Reserve: This stunning nature reserve is a must-visit for hiking enthusiasts. The Robberg Peninsula offers breathtaking views of the rugged coastline and is home to a variety of wildlife, including seals and dolphins.

2. Hit the beach: Plettenberg Bay is known for its pristine beaches, perfect for sunbathing, swimming, and water sports. Lookout Beach and Central Beach are popular choices for visitors looking to soak up the sun and relax by the ocean.

3. Visit the Plett Puzzle Park: This quirky attraction is a fun-filled maze park that offers a unique and challenging experience for all ages. Test your puzzle-solving skills as you navigate through the maze and enjoy some brain-teasing games along the way.

4. Take a boat tour: Explore the waters around Plettenberg Bay on a boat tour, where you can spot marine life such as whales, dolphins, and seals. Sunset cruises are also a popular choice for those looking to enjoy a relaxing evening on the water.

5. Explore Tsitsikamma National Park: Just a short drive from Plett, Tsitsikamma National Park is a must-visit for nature lovers. The park is home to lush forests, dramatic cliffs, and the famous Storms River Mouth. Hike along the suspension bridges and soak in the beauty of this untouched wilderness.

6. Indulge in local cuisine: Plettenberg Bay is home to a vibrant dining scene, with a variety of restaurants offering fresh seafood, local produce, and delicious South African cuisine. Don’t miss the chance to sample some of the region’s specialties, such as biltong and traditional braai (barbecue).

Whether you’re seeking adventure, relaxation, or a little bit of both, Plettenberg Bay has something for everyone. So pack your bags, hit the road, and get ready to experience the beauty and charm of this seaside town on the Garden Route. You won’t be disappointed!
